What companies run services between Hawthorne, CA, USA and Compton, CA, USA?

You can take a vehicle from Hawthorne / Lennox Station to Compton Station via Willowbrook - Rosa Parks Station - Metro C-Line and Willowbrook - Rosa Parks Station - Metro A-Line in around 21 min. Alternatively, Metro Los Angeles operates a bus from Rosecrans / Doty to Rosecrans / Acacia every 30 minutes. Tickets cost $1–2 and the journey takes 32 min.
